Anime News
Ys VIII: Lacrimosa Of Dana Game's Switch Video Shows Gameplay Date: 6/4/2018 |
Switch game ships on June 26 in N. America, on June 29 in Europe |
Source: Anime News Network |
Ys VIII: Lacrimosa Of Dana Game's Switch Video Shows Gameplay Date: 6/4/2018 |
Switch game ships on June 26 in N. America, on June 29 in Europe |
Source: Anime News Network |